In the given figure, ABCD is a quadrilateral and BE AC and also BE meets DC produced at E. Show that the area of ∆ADE is equal to the area of quad. ABCD.

Given: BE ||AC


We know that any two or more Triangles having the same base and lying between the same parallel lines are equal in area.


Area (Δ ACE) = Area (Δ ACB) –1


Add Area (Δ ADC) on both sides of eq –1


We get,


Area (Δ ACE) + Area (Δ ADC) = Area (Δ ACB) + Area (Δ ADC)


That is,


Area (Δ ADE) = Area (quad. ABCD)
